The Growing Importance of Battery Energy Storage in Florida

As the state of Florida continues to embrace renewable energy resources, the significance of battery energy storage systems (BESS) cannot be overstated. With the increasing influx of solar energy, combined with the frequent severe weather conditions such as hurricanes, energy storage solutions are becoming essential for maintaining a resilient and sustainable energy grid. This article will explore the current landscape of battery energy storage in Florida, its benefits, applications, challenges, and future prospects.

Understanding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S)

Battery energy storage systems (BESS) are technologies that store energy for later use. They convert electrical energy into chemical energy during periods of low demand and discharge it back into the grid or load when needed. Various technologies are employed in battery energy storage systems, with lithium-ion batteries being the most prominent due to their efficiency, longevity, and decreasing costs.

The Solar Revolution in Florida

Florida, known as the "Sunshine State," has unmatched potential for solar energy production. With an average of 237 sunny days per year, the state has been rapidly increasing its solar capacity. The Florida Solar Energy Industries Association (FlaSEIA) reports that Florida now ranks among the top five states in the U.S. for solar energy generation. This expansion has been fueled by legislative support, falling costs of photovoltaic systems, and increased public awareness of environmental issues.

However, solar energy generation is intermittent and dependent on weather conditions. This impermanence presents challenges that highlight the necessity of integrating battery storage. By storing the excess energy generated during sunny periods, Florida can ensure a stable energy supply even on cloudy days or during peak demand times.

Benefits of Battery Energy Storage Systems

1. Enhancing Grid Stability

Battery energy storage plays a crucial role in stabilizing the grid. It allows for the balancing of supply and demand by storing surplus energy and releasing it when demand spikes. This function is vital for preventing blackouts and ensuring a reliable energy supply, particularly during peak usage times or emergencies aligned with Florida's hurricane season.

2. Supporting Renewable Energy Integration

Electric grids worldwide are integrating more renewable sources. Battery storage acts as a buffer, accommodating the variability of renewables like solar and wind. In Florida, this is especially relevant, given the state's growing investment in solar farms. The more we can integrate these renewable sources while utilizing storage, the closer we come to achieving energy independence.

3. Cost Savings

Energy storage systems can potentially reduce electricity costs for both consumers and utility companies. By deploying BESS during off-peak hours, users can store energy at lower rates and utilize it during peak hours when prices are higher. Utilities can also defer investments in infrastructure, like building new power plants, by employing BESS to meet demand.

Applications of Battery Energy Storage in Florida

The applications of battery energy storage in Florida are numerous and varied, catering to both residential and commercial needs.

1. Residential Applications

Home battery storage systems allow homeowners in Florida to maximize their solar investments. By storing excess solar energy produced during the day, families can use stored energy at night or during power outages. This enhances energy security and autonomy from grid dependencies.

2. Utility-Scale Solutions

Several utility companies in Florida are investing in large-scale battery storage systems. These systems contribute to grid stabilization and provide ancillary services such as frequency regulation and voltage support. By adopting BESS on a larger scale, utilities can optimize their operations and improve service reliability.

3. Commercial and Industrial Use

For commercial and industrial facilities, energy storage can aid in demand response programs. By managing energy consumption intelligently, businesses can reduce their electricity bills and improve overall operational efficiency. Additionally, companies can assert sustainability credentials by decreasing their carbon footprint while supporting renewable energy use.

Challenges Facing Battery Energy Storage in Florida

Despite its myriad advantages, the deployment of battery energy storage systems in Florida faces several challenges.

1. Initial Costs

Although battery prices are declining, the initial investment for residential and commercial storage systems can still be a barrier for many. Financial incentives and rebates from federal and state programs can alleviate some burden, but the industry still contends with upfront costs that deter widespread adoption.

2. Regulatory Framework

The regulatory landscape in Florida must evolve to facilitate the growth of battery energy storage systems. Policymakers need to establish clear guidelines and frameworks that encourage investment and protect consumers. Without supportive legislation, significant barriers to deployment and integration may persist.

The Future of Battery Energy Storage in Florida

Looking ahead, the future of battery energy storage in Florida appears promising. As technology advances, we anticipate further declines in costs, improvements in efficiency, and an increase in the lifespan of battery systems. Furthermore, innovative solutions and combinations of technologies, such as coupling battery storage with wind energy, could further enhance the state's energy landscape.

Ongoing governmental initiatives and private investments may foster an environment ripe for growth and adoption of energy storage solutions in Florida.
